Why Deteriorated Mortar Matters

So, why should you care about deteriorated mortar joints, you ask? That’s a fair question! Well, consider this: over time, the stress induced by wind can create cracks and separation in those mortar joints. Think about mortar as the glue that holds everything together. If the glue starts to fail, you might end up with more than a few unsightly lines; you could compromise the stability of the whole structure.

Here's a little analogy for you: imagine building a sandcastle on a beach. If a wave repeatedly washes over it, the edges begin to erode, right? Just like that sandcastle, your chimney—and its mortar joints—can succumb to the ever-persistent forces of nature.

Beyond Just Mortar: A Costly Ripple Effect

But wait, there’s more! Deteriorated mortar joints can lead to a variety of other nasty problems. Once those joints start to weaken, they create pathways for water to intrude. This is particularly problematic during freeze-thaw cycles. You know those chilly winter nights where that beautiful blanket of snow turns into a slippery mess come morning? Water gets into those cracks, freezes overnight, and expands, causing even further deterioration. It’s like a relentless cycle of damage.

You might be saying, “Alright, so my chimney looks a little worse for wear. What’s the worst that can happen?” Well, ignoring those cracks and decay can escalate the situation to structural failure. And trust me, no one wants to deal with a crumbling chimney—it’s not just ugly, it’s a significant safety hazard! Imagine the horror of a chimney collapsing; it could spell disaster for your home and family.

Keeping Your Chimney Healthy: What You Can Do

So, how can you keep your chimney safe from the destructive forces of Mother Nature? Regular inspection and maintenance are key! It may not sound glamorous, but taking the time to check for cracks and deterioration can save you from a costly mess later on. Here are a few helpful tips:

  1. Routine Inspections: Aim for annual checks. Look for visible cracks or signs of water damage. If climbing onto your roof isn’t your idea of a fun Saturday, consider hiring a professional.

  2. Seasonal Cleaning: Regularly cleaning out your chimney can also prevent debris accumulation, which could potentially exacerbate issues.

  3. Watch for Changes: If you notice your chimney leaning or misaligned, don’t wait for the wind to do more damage—address it promptly.

  4. Consult the Experts: Consider engaging with a qualified chimney sweep who specializes in masonry work. They can help ensure it’s in fighting form for all seasons!
